BALTIMORE (April 11, 2024)—The Goucher College Poll was conducted from April 3 to 7, 2024. It surveyed 705 Baltimore City registered voters (MOE=+/-3.7%). Voters were asked about their opinions on key officials, entities, and issues in Baltimore City; their opinions on the direction of and their optimism toward Baltimore City; their perceptions of the crime rate and causes of crime; and the impact of the Francis Scott Key Bridge collapse and how public officials handled it.
